"일꾼이 일을 잘하려면 먼저 도구를 갈고 닦아야 한다." - 공자, 『논어』.
첫 장 > 프로그램 작성 > UTF-8 vs. Latin-1 : 캐릭터 인코딩의 비밀!

UTF-8 vs. Latin-1 : 캐릭터 인코딩의 비밀!

2025-03-12에 게시되었습니다
검색:674

UTF-8 vs. Latin-1: What are the Key Differences in Character Encoding?

The Critical Distinction

At the core of the distinction lies their respective approaches to representing non-Latin characters. LATIN1은 라틴 캐릭터에 특히 적합하지만 UTF-8은 중국어, 일본어, 히브리어 및 러시아어를 포함한 다양한 언어의 캐릭터를 수용 할 수있는 능력을 자랑합니다. 이 다양성은 UTF-8이 전 세계 콘텐츠를 원활하게 처리 할 수있게하여 원산지에 관계없이 캐릭터가 정확하게 렌더링되도록합니다.

는 대조적으로 Latin1의 제한된 문자 세트는 비 라틴 문자를 처리하는 데 부적합합니다. Latin1 인코딩을 사용하여 이러한 문자를 저장하려고 시도하면 "Mojibake"가 스크램블 된 기호의 수수께끼의 표시입니다.

는 Latin1에 비해 몇 가지 추가 장점을 소유합니다. 역사적으로 MySQL의 UTF-8에 대한 지원은 문자 당 3 바이트로 제한되어 기본 다국어 평면 (BMP) 외부의 문자 표현을 방해했습니다. 그러나 MySQL 5.5의 출현으로 전체 4 바이트 UTF-8 지원이 도입되어 이모티콘 평면을 포함하기 위해 도달 범위를 확장했습니다.

대조적으로 Latin1의 인코딩 제한은 지속적으로 전 세계 커뮤니케이션의 영역에 적응력이 떨어집니다. 제한된 캐릭터 세트는 특히 오늘날의 상호 연결되고 언어 적으로 다양한 세상에서 중요한 단점으로 남아 있습니다.

UTF-8 vs. Latin-1: What are the Key Differences in Character Encoding?

는 UTF-8 스탠드로서 포괄적 인 인코딩 솔루션을 찾습니다. 광범위한 캐릭터를 원활하게 수용하는 능력은 세계화 된 콘텐츠에 이상적인 선택이되어 문화적 경계에서 효과적인 의사 소통을 가능하게합니다. Latin1은 라틴 기반 언어에 충분하지만 다양한 캐릭터 요구 사항에 부족합니다.

최신 튜토리얼 더>

부인 성명: 제공된 모든 리소스는 부분적으로 인터넷에서 가져온 것입니다. 귀하의 저작권이나 기타 권리 및 이익이 침해된 경우 자세한 이유를 설명하고 저작권 또는 권리 및 이익에 대한 증거를 제공한 후 이메일([email protected])로 보내주십시오. 최대한 빨리 처리해 드리겠습니다.

Copyright© 2022 湘ICP备2022001581号-3